
在Excel中查找相同姓名的个数,可以使用COUNTIF函数、数据透视表、条件格式等多种方法来实现。本文将详细介绍这些方法,并提供操作步骤和实例,帮助你在不同情况下选择最适合的方法。
一、使用COUNTIF函数
1. COUNTIF函数简介
COUNTIF函数是Excel中最常用的统计函数之一,用于统计满足特定条件的单元格个数。其基本语法为:COUNTIF(range, criteria),其中range表示要统计的范围,criteria表示条件。
2. 操作步骤
- 选择目标单元格:在你希望显示结果的单元格中输入公式。
- 输入公式:假设你的姓名数据在A列,从A2到A100,那么可以在B2单元格输入公式:
=COUNTIF($A$2:$A$100, A2)。按下Enter键后,B2单元格将显示A2单元格中的姓名在A列中出现的次数。 - 复制公式:将B2单元格的公式复制到其他单元格以统计其他姓名的次数。
通过这种方法,你可以快速统计每个姓名在数据范围内出现的次数。
3. 实例展示
假设你的姓名数据如下:
| 姓名 |
|---|
| 张三 |
| 李四 |
| 张三 |
| 王五 |
| 李四 |
| 张三 |
在B2单元格输入公式:=COUNTIF($A$2:$A$7, A2),然后向下拖动填充公式,结果如下:
| 姓名 | 出现次数 |
|---|---|
| 张三 | 3 |
| 李四 | 2 |
| 张三 | 3 |
| 王五 | 1 |
| 李四 | 2 |
| 张三 | 3 |
二、使用数据透视表
1. 数据透视表简介
数据透视表是Excel中强大的数据分析工具,可以快速汇总和分析数据。通过数据透视表,可以轻松统计相同姓名的个数。
2. 操作步骤
- 选择数据范围:选中包含姓名的数据区域。
- 插入数据透视表:点击“插入”选项卡,然后选择“数据透视表”。
- 创建数据透视表:在弹出的窗口中选择数据源和放置数据透视表的位置,点击“确定”。
- 设置字段:在数据透视表字段列表中,将“姓名”字段拖动到“行”和“值”区域。此时,数据透视表将自动统计每个姓名的出现次数。
3. 实例展示
假设你的姓名数据如下:
| 姓名 |
|---|
| 张三 |
| 李四 |
| 张三 |
| 王五 |
| 李四 |
| 张三 |
通过上述操作步骤,生成的数据透视表如下:
| 姓名 | 计数 |
|---|---|
| 张三 | 3 |
| 李四 | 2 |
| 王五 | 1 |
三、使用条件格式
1. 条件格式简介
条件格式是Excel中用于突出显示特定数据的工具,可以根据设定的条件自动更改单元格的格式。通过条件格式,可以快速识别和统计相同姓名的个数。
2. 操作步骤
- 选择数据范围:选中包含姓名的数据区域。
- 应用条件格式:点击“开始”选项卡,然后选择“条件格式”。
- 设置条件:选择“新建规则”,在规则类型中选择“使用公式确定要设置格式的单元格”。输入公式
=COUNTIF($A$2:$A$100, A2)>1,然后设置格式(如填充颜色)。 - 应用规则:点击“确定”应用条件格式。
通过这种方法,你可以快速识别重复的姓名,并通过格式变化进行统计。
3. 实例展示
假设你的姓名数据如下:
| 姓名 |
|---|
| 张三 |
| 李四 |
| 张三 |
| 王五 |
| 李四 |
| 张三 |
通过上述操作步骤,所有重复的姓名将被高亮显示,方便你进行统计。
四、使用高级筛选
1. 高级筛选简介
高级筛选是Excel中用于筛选特定数据的工具,可以根据设定的条件筛选出符合条件的数据。通过高级筛选,可以快速统计相同姓名的个数。
2. 操作步骤
- 选择数据范围:选中包含姓名的数据区域。
- 应用高级筛选:点击“数据”选项卡,然后选择“高级”。
- 设置筛选条件:在弹出的窗口中选择“将筛选结果复制到其他位置”,设置条件范围和目标区域。
- 执行筛选:点击“确定”执行高级筛选。
通过这种方法,你可以快速筛选出相同的姓名,并通过计数进行统计。
3. 实例展示
假设你的姓名数据如下:
| 姓名 |
|---|
| 张三 |
| 李四 |
| 张三 |
| 王五 |
| 李四 |
| 张三 |
通过上述操作步骤,筛选结果如下:
| 姓名 |
|---|
| 张三 |
| 李四 |
| 张三 |
| 李四 |
| 张三 |
通过计数可以得出相同姓名的个数。
五、总结
在Excel中查找相同姓名的个数,有多种方法可以选择,如使用COUNTIF函数、数据透视表、条件格式、高级筛选等。每种方法都有其优点和适用场景,具体选择哪种方法可以根据实际需求和数据情况来定。
- COUNTIF函数:适用于快速统计特定范围内相同姓名的个数,操作简单,结果直观。
- 数据透视表:适用于大数据量的汇总和分析,可以生成详细的统计报表。
- 条件格式:适用于快速识别和高亮重复的姓名,方便进行人工统计。
- 高级筛选:适用于复杂条件下的数据筛选和统计,灵活性高。
通过本文的介绍,相信你已经掌握了在Excel中查找相同姓名个数的多种方法,并能根据实际情况选择最适合的方法进行操作。希望本文对你有所帮助,祝你在Excel数据处理和分析中取得更好的效果。
相关问答FAQs:
1. 如何在Excel中查找相同姓名的个数?
在Excel中查找相同姓名的个数非常简单。你可以按照以下步骤操作:
- 选择要查找的姓名所在的列。
- 在Excel菜单栏中选择“开始”选项卡。
- 在“编辑”组下找到“查找和选择”按钮,并点击它。
- 在弹出的对话框中,输入要查找的姓名,并点击“查找全部”按钮。
- Excel会显示出所有匹配到的姓名,并在最下方的状态栏中显示相同姓名的个数。
2. 如何快速统计Excel表格中相同姓名的个数?
如果你想要快速统计Excel表格中相同姓名的个数,你可以使用Excel中的公式功能。
- 在一个空白单元格中,输入以下公式:=COUNTIF(选择要查找的姓名所在的列, "要查找的姓名")
- 将“选择要查找的姓名所在的列”替换为你要查找的姓名所在的列的范围,例如A1:A10。
- 将“要查找的姓名”替换为你要统计的具体姓名。
- 按下回车键,Excel会立即显示出相同姓名的个数。
3. 如何使用筛选功能在Excel中筛选相同姓名的数据?
在Excel中,你可以使用筛选功能轻松筛选出相同姓名的数据。
- 选择姓名所在的列。
- 在Excel菜单栏中选择“数据”选项卡。
- 在“筛选”组下找到“筛选”按钮,并点击它。
- 在姓名列的标题栏上出现一个下拉箭头,点击该箭头。
- 在弹出的下拉菜单中选择要筛选的具体姓名。
- Excel会立即显示出与该姓名匹配的所有数据行,其他数据行将被隐藏起来。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4227511